6. GDPR Legal Bases
Where GDPR applies, personal information may be processed based on:
Contract
Where processing is necessary to provide requested services or perform contractual obligations.
Legitimate Interests
Where processing is reasonably necessary for legitimate business purposes while appropriately considering individual privacy rights.
Consent
Where an individual has consented to specified processing and consent is required.
Legal Obligation
Where processing is necessary to comply with applicable law.
Consent may be withdrawn where processing relies on consent.
7. Controller and Processor Roles
Modessa Pulse may act as either a data controller or data processor depending on the circumstances.
Modessa Pulse generally acts as a controller when processing information about its own customers, prospective customers, website visitors, administrators and business contacts.
When businesses use Modessa Pulse to collect or manage information regarding their customers, prospects or other individuals, that business generally determines the purposes of processing and may be the data controller.
In those circumstances, Modessa Pulse may act as a processor or service provider on behalf of that business.
